Chef Grant Gillon is an Iowa-based private chef and passionate advocate for local agriculture. Known for his bold flavors and refined technique, Grant rose to national recognition as the winner of MasterChef Season 13, showcasing his ability to blend creativity with heartland ingredients.

At the core of his cooking is a deep commitment to farm-to-table sourcing. Grant partners closely with Iowa farmers, dairies, and producers to build menus that celebrate the season and tell the story of the land. Each dish reflects his belief that great food starts with great relationships — from pasture to plate.

Calvin Schnucker is the founder and head butcher of The Good Butcher in Des Moines, Iowa. With nearly 20 years in the meat industry, he specializes in whole-animal butchery, house-made sausages, and traditional dry-cured charcuterie. Calvin is passionate about sourcing high-quality meats from local farms and bringing old-world butcher craftsmanship back to the neighborhood shop.
